Trio Nova Mundi

For Trio Nova Mundi, the New World stands for two continents rich in musical culture. The members of this trio bring together musical training and heritage from several corners of the Americas: Rodrigo Ojeda (Venezuela), Maureen Conlon Gutiérrez (Mexico), Kathryn Bates (United States). The Trio promotes music and composers of the Americas, performing established repertoire as well as new or lesser-known works and also supports classical music in Latin-American communities in the USA and Latin America.

Founded in 2001, the Trio has given numerous concerts in Houston, TX, Pittsburgh, PA, and throughout Mexico on several tours, the most recent in June 2008. Traveling to Ecuador in 2002, they appeared as international artists at the Mes Franz Liszt series in Quito, part of the Franz Liszt Academy. 2006 marked their first performance of the Beethoven Triple Concerto in Atlanta with conductor Juan Ramírez. Members of the Trio were coached by members of the Guarneri, Emerson, Cleveland, Concord, Tokyo, Ying, and Casals String Quartets as well as the Beaux Arts and Peabody Piano Trios.
